web-dev-qa-db-ja.com

サーバータスクマネージャーのApp-Vプロセス

私は、データセンター環境でアプリケーションの使用状況を測定するためのサービスを提供するベンダー企業で働いています。最近、App-Vメータリングをサポートするかどうか尋ねられました。

App-Vアプリケーションと、それを実行するクライアントマシンでのそれらの表現について質問があります。 App-Vパッケージアプリケーション(MS Wordなど)を実行するクライアントマシンAがある場合、そのアプリケーションはクライアントマシンのホストタスクマネージャーにどのように表示されますか? App-Vの事前パッケージなしで通常表示されるのと同じプロセス名で表示されますか? (例:Word.exeはタスクマネージャーに表示されます)。そうでない場合は、この情報にアクセスするためにクライアントマシンで利用できる一般的なコマンドラインユーティリティ/ APIがありますか。

これが明らかな場合はお詫び申し上げますが、オンラインで簡単な答えを見つけることができませんでした。

ベスト、

ヴィヴェーク

1
Vivek

はい、仮想化されていないネイティブのWordとまったく同じように見えます。仮想化されたものとしてそれを見つける方法があります。

まず、画像パスを確認できます。 winword.exeのロード元。仮想化されている場合は、C:\ ProgramData\App-V \(少なくともデフォルトの場所)の下から実行されます。

また、App-Vによって仮想化されたものとして識別でき、ロードされたライブラリを確認できます。 AppVEntSubsystem32.dllがロードされると、仮想化されます。

これは完全な答えではないと確信していますが、お役に立てば幸いです。

0
Gomibushi